Entain has revealed interesting betting insights from the recently finished 2024 Olympics in Paris. It announced on Friday that the betting handle was double that of the 2020 Tokyo games, which took place in 2021 because of the COVID-19 pandemic. The UK-based gambling group cited the more convenient time zone as a key reason for the success.

The sports that bettors on Entain-owned platforms like Coral, Ladbrokes, bwin, and BetMGM took the most interest in, in terms of volume of bets, were basketball, soccer, tennis, volleyball, and handball. The men’s basketball final featuring the star-studded USA team against home side France generated more wagers than any other individual game or competition.

Athletics wagering also saw a strong uptick, with the men’s 100m final being the most popular event. Bettors cashed in on heavy favorite Noah Lyles, who claimed victory by just .005 seconds. One of the bigger surprises was American Cole Hocker capturing gold in the men’s 1500m final at a price of +2000.

Talking about the results, Entain Head of Sports Arild Ostbo said it was an unforgettable Olympics and it “continues to grow in popularity and betting interest.”
